Responsibilities of a Live-in Caregiver
Essential Functions:
Delivering exceptional care to the dedicated clients in their home
Help execute comprehensive personalized weekly schedules and care plans
Complete daily tasks in a safe and professional manner (ADLs)
Supply personal companionship, remaining actively engaged with each client by providing ongoing social & emotional support
Assist with personal care activities, light housekeeping, feeding and meal preparation
Keep order, safety and client enjoyment top of mind at all times
Provide transportation to and from appointments as needed
Administrative functions such as documentation of completion of tasks and report changes in the client’s physical condition, mental capability or behavior
Qualifications
Requirements:
Minimum of one year of caregiving experience
Valid Driver's license and vehicle insurance
Must have a reliable means of transportation to get to and from work
Successful completion of all state requirements and required state and Company training
Pass a background check
Pass an Employee Misconduct Registry (EMR) check, as defined by Texas law
Ability to follow written and verbal care instructions, and document timely and accurately in systems
Empathy for the needs of the client
Treats clients, staff, and the public with courtesy, respect, and presents a positive public image
Maintains confidentiality and security of the client’s medical information
Non-Required Preferred Skills, Education and Certifications:
High school diploma or equivalent
Licensure as a CNA, HHA, PCA, HCA, CHHA is a plus
CPR and First Aid Certification
